Transaction 5d77f84dbfd0860c99593d5b773548ffad1b6f6c54f85b5ca93ea9985aa231b0
1 Input
1 Output
-
5d77f84dbfd0860c99593d5b773548ffad1b6f6c54f85b5ca93ea9985aa231b0:0
- value
- 31609600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e41d24532d891ac2d2e90adab3be83c4424eaa6c OP_EQUAL
- address
- 3NVAu6VATC8pwULhZHpt2cbTpWe7U3GnXw